Day 1

Day 1: Arrival & Tea Garden Exploration

Arrive at Munnar by morning (4-5 hours from Kochi). Check into your hotel and freshen up. Visit Tata Tea Museum (10 AM-4 PM) to learn about tea processing, then explore the sprawling green tea gardens around Munnar town. Evening walk through the local market and sunset at Kundala Lake viewpoint.

Day 2

Day 2: Anamudi Trek & Mattupetty Dam

Early morning trek to Anamudi Peak (2,695m), India's highest peak in Western Ghats - 6-7 hour trek with guide (₹1,500). Alternatively, visit Mattupetty Dam for boating (₹200/person) and Echo Point. Afternoon visit to Kundala Lake for scenic views and light trekking. Return by evening for dinner.

Day 3

Day 3: Waterfalls & Spice Gardens

Visit Attukal Waterfalls (30 km away, 1.5 hours drive) for swimming and photography. Stop at Rajakkad Viewpoint en route for panoramic views. Afternoon visit to spice gardens to see cardamom, pepper, and cinnamon plantations. Evening visit to Eravikulam National Park for Nilgiri Tahr spotting (entry ₹250/person).

Day 4

Day 4: Departure & Last-Minute Exploration

Morning visit to Top Station (highest point in Munnar, 2,000m) for misty views and photography. Stop at Pothamedu Viewpoint for panoramic tea garden vistas. Lunch at a local restaurant trying Kerala cuisine. Afternoon departure to Kochi or onward destination.

Frequently Asked Questions — Munnar Trip

Q: What is the best time to visit Munnar?
A: October to May is ideal, with December-February being peak season offering clear skies and cool weather (10-20°C). Avoid monsoon months (May-September) due to heavy rainfall and landslide risks. October-November offers post-monsoon freshness with fewer crowds and lower prices.
Q: How many days are enough for a Munnar trip?
A: 3-4 days is ideal to experience major attractions like Anamudi trek, tea gardens, waterfalls, and viewpoints. For a relaxed trip with multiple treks and exploration, 5-6 days is recommended. Even 2 days works for a quick getaway focusing on tea gardens and viewpoints.
Q: Is Anamudi trek difficult and how long does it take?
A: Anamudi trek is moderately difficult, suitable for people with basic fitness. The trek takes 6-7 hours round trip (3-3.5 hours up, 2.5-3 hours down) covering 8-10 km. A guide is mandatory (₹1,500-2,000) and can be arranged through hotels. Start early morning (5-6 AM) to complete before sunset.
Q: What is the average budget for a Munnar trip?
A: For a couple, budget ₹25,000-35,000 for 4 days including accommodation (₹3,000-5,000/night), meals (₹1,500-2,000/day), activities (₹2,000-3,000/day), and transport. Budget travelers can manage ₹15,000-20,000 by choosing homestays and local transport. Peak season (Dec-Feb) prices are 30-40% higher.
Q: How do I reach Munnar from Kochi?
A: Munnar is 110 km from Kochi, taking 4-5 hours by road. Options include: private taxi (₹2,500-3,500), shared cab (₹600-800/person), or rental car (₹2,000-3,000/day). No direct trains or flights; nearest airport is Kochi International Airport. The road journey is scenic, passing through Western Ghats.
